AI Summary

  • Defines "entity" in Minnesota Statutes to include firms, corporations, associations, limited liability companies, partnerships, nonprofits, and other business, religious, or charitable organizations.

  • Grants immunity from civil damages and administrative sanctions to entities or their agents who volunteer without compensation to assist local jurisdictions during emergencies or disasters if they pre-register and operate under the jurisdiction's direction and control.

  • Extends the same immunity protections to entities or their agents volunteering without compensation to assist state agencies during emergencies or disasters, provided they pre-register with the state agency and remain under its direction and control.

  • Excludes immunity protection if the entity or agent acts in a willful and wanton or reckless manner while providing emergency care, advice, or assistance.

  • Takes effect the day following final enactment and applies to actions accruing on or after that date.

Legislative Description

Immunity from liability for volunteer entities assisting a local jurisdiction during an emergency or disaster
